So sánh chi phí gia công phần mềm tại các khu vực trên thế giới. Điều gì dẫn đến sự khác biệt?

So sánh chi phí gia công phần mềm tại các khu vực trên thế giới. Điều gì dẫn đến sự khác biệt?

Theo bài “How Much Does it Cost to Hire a Software Developer in India?” của trang Vrinsofts, nếu so sánh chi phí gia công phần mềm tại các khu vực trên thế giới, có thể thấy để thuê một kỹ sư phần mềm ở Ấn Độ chỉ với 15 USD/giờ, trong khi đó, theo bài “How Much Does It Cost to Hire a Software Developer: A Complete Guide” của trang SpaceO phải tốn đến 150 USD/giờ cho cùng công việc tại Mỹ. Vậy điều gì tạo nên sự khác biệt lớn đến vậy?

Trong khi ngày càng nhiều doanh nghiệp Việt tìm đến mô hình Offshore Outsourcing để tiết kiệm chi phí thì rất ít người hiểu rõ tại sao giá lại chênh lệch khủng khiếp giữa các khu vực và đâu là ranh giới giữa “giá rẻ thông minh” và “rẻ mà rủi ro cao”.

Bài viết này sẽ giúp bạn nắm rõ những yếu tố cốt lõi quyết định chi phí gia công phần mềm trên toàn cầu.

Chi phí sinh hoạt và mức lương tối thiểu tại từng quốc gia

Đây là yếu tố cơ bản nhất ảnh hưởng đến giá thuê đơn vị phát triển phần mềm Offshore. Các quốc gia có mức sống cao như Mỹ, Anh và Singapore sẽ phải trả lương cao hơn gấp nhiều lần so với các nước đang phát triển.

Các đất nước có mức lương cao phải trả chi phí gia công phần mềm cao hơn rất nhiều so với các nước khác
Các đất nước có mức lương cao phải trả chi phí gia công phần mềm cao hơn rất nhiều so với các nước khác

Tại Mỹ, lương cho một nhân sự Dev senior sẽ dao động từ 120.000 – 180.000 USD/năm. Trong khi đó, tại Việt Nam lương cho một nhân sự Dev senior trung bình chỉ từ 20.000 – 30.000 USD/năm, mặc dù cùng năng lực nhưng chi phí đầu người có thể chênh gấp 5–6 lần

Năng lực kỹ thuật, kinh nghiệm và độ chuyên sâu của nhân lực

Chi phí không chỉ phụ thuộc vào địa lý mà còn vào năng lực thật sự của đội ngũ phát triển. Những khu vực có kỹ năng chuyên sâu sẽ có mức giá cao hơn nhưng năng suất thường cao hơn rõ rệt. 

Quốc giaĐiểm mạnh kỹ thuật tiêu biểu
UkraineBackend phức tạp, fintech, AI, IoT
Ấn ĐộLực lượng lớn, đa dạng công nghệ
Việt NamWeb app, mobile app, hệ thống ERP/CRM
PhilippinesQA, hỗ trợ kỹ thuật, BPO
Mỹ/AnhProduct management, kiến trúc hệ thống lớn

Khác biệt về quy trình quản lý dự án và tiêu chuẩn chất lượng

Một công ty có quy trình Agile chặt chẽ, sử dụng CI/CD, quản lý bằng Jira và review code định kỳ sẽ có chi phí gia công phần mềm cao hơn nhưng giảm rủi ro và tăng khả năng mở rộng.

Công ty sở hữu quy trình triển khai dự án càng chặt chẽ thì chi phí gia công phần mềm sẽ càng cao
Công ty sở hữu quy trình triển khai dự án càng chặt chẽ thì chi phí gia công phần mềm sẽ càng cao

Ở các thị trường phát triển như Mỹ và EU, việc này là tiêu chuẩn bắt buộc. Ở một số thị trường giá rẻ, doanh nghiệp có thể gặp tình huống không có document, không test hoặc không bảo hành. Chính vì vậy mà thực trạng rẻ trước, đắt sau là hệ quả phổ biến nếu không kiểm tra quy trình quản lý.

>>> Xem thêm: Công thức tối ưu ngân sách gia công phần mềm mà mọi doanh nghiệp lớn đều áp dụng

Nền tảng pháp lý, bảo mật dữ liệu và tiêu chuẩn quốc tế

Ở các nước như EU, Mỹ và Singapore việc tuân thủ các tiêu chuẩn như GDPR, ISO 27001, SOC 2 gần như bắt buộc. Các đơn vị tuân thủ đầy đủ sẽ có chi phí cao hơn vì tốn kém trong việc duy trì bảo mật.

Các công ty tuân thủ bảo mật và pháp lý sẽ có chi phí gia công phần mềm cao
Các công ty tuân thủ bảo mật và pháp lý sẽ có chi phí gia công phần mềm cao

Ngược lại, nếu thuê đơn vị không có hợp đồng rõ ràng, không NDA, doanh nghiệp có thể gặp rủi ro pháp lý và mất dữ liệu đặc biệt với dự án tài chính, y tế hoặc quản trị người dùng.

Khả năng giao tiếp và múi giờ phối hợp

Dù không nằm trong chi phí “trực tiếp” nhưng đây là yếu tố gây tổn thất lớn về năng suất. Chính vì vậy mà mô hình Nearshore mới trở thành mô hình gia công phần mềm được các công ty Việt Nam quan tâm nhiều hơn gần đây.

Mô hình múi giờẢnh hưởng đến chi phí thực tế
Lệch múi giờ > 6 tiếngGiao tiếp gián đoạn, phản hồi chậm
Giao tiếp yếu (tiếng Anh kém)Sai lệch yêu cầu → sửa lại nhiều lần
Múi giờ gần, response nhanhTăng hiệu suất, giảm lãng phí quản lý

Tầm vóc và danh tiếng của công ty gia công

Một công ty gia công phần mềm có thương hiệu và từng làm việc với khách hàng quốc tế lớn như Samsung, BOSCH hay IBM sẽ tính giá cao hơn. Tuy nhiên, sự chênh lệch này nằm ở năng lực triển khai bài bản và khả năng mở rộng về sau.

Công ty có danh tiếng thì chi phí gia công phần mềm sẽ cao hơn các công ty khác
Công ty có danh tiếng thì chi phí gia công phần mềm sẽ cao hơn các công ty khác

Đối với doanh nghiệp Việt, đôi khi lựa chọn công ty tầm trung, có quy trình chuẩn hóa nhưng chi phí vừa phải lại là lựa chọn hợp lý hơn rất nhiều so với các vendor “siêu to khổng lồ”.

Bảng so sánh chi phí gia công phần mềm và lập trình viên trung bình theo khu vực (USD/giờ)

Khu vựcMức giá trung bình (USD/giờ)Ghi chú nổi bật
Bắc Mỹ (Mỹ, Canada)100 – 180Kỹ năng cao, chi phí sống cao, quy trình tiêu chuẩn
Tây Âu (Đức, Anh, Pháp)70 – 120Bảo mật mạnh, tuân thủ GDPR
Đông Âu (Ukraine, Ba Lan)30 – 60Chất lượng tốt, giá hợp lý, nhiều công ty uy tín
Đông Nam Á (Việt Nam, Philippines, Malaysia)18 – 45Giao tiếp khá, đang được ưa chuộng bởi startup
Nam Á (Ấn Độ, Bangladesh)12 – 35Giá rẻ, nguồn lực lớn, chênh lệch chất lượng cao
Châu Phi (Nigeria, Kenya)10 – 25Chi phí thấp, lực lượng đang phát triển

Nguồn: IT Services Pricing Guide 2025, Software Development Company Pricing Guide 2025, US vs International Developers: Do Overseas Developers Get a Bad Rap?

Quy trình lựa chọn khu vực thuê với chi phí gia công phù hợp – Góc nhìn dành cho doanh nghiệp Việt

Việc chọn thuê lập trình viên hay đội gia công phần mềm từ đâu không chỉ là bài toán về  giá mà còn là quyết định về rủi ro, quản lý và hiệu suất tổng thể. Dưới đây là quy trình 5 bước giúp doanh nghiệp Việt chọn đúng khu vực, đúng năng lực và đúng chi phí.

Quy trình lựa chọn khu vực phù hợp với mức chi phí thuê gia công của doanh nghiệp
Quy trình lựa chọn khu vực phù hợp với mức chi phí thuê gia công của doanh nghiệp

Bước 1: Đánh giá nội lực và năng lực kiểm soát của chính doanh nghiệp

Câu hỏi tự đặt raGợi ý hành động
Doanh nghiệp có nhân sự kỹ thuật nội bộ không?Nếu CÓ có thể chọn Offshore, nếu KHÔNG hãy cân nhắc Onshore/Nearshore có hỗ trợ tư vấn
Có PM/BA giao tiếp được tiếng Anh kỹ thuật không?Nếu KHÔNG hãy tránh các khu vực nói tiếng Anh yếu hoặc lệch múi giờ quá xa
Sản phẩm có yêu cầu bảo mật dữ liệu nghiêm ngặt không?Nếu CÓ chỉ chọn đơn vị ở các quốc gia có quy chuẩn bảo mật rõ ràng

Bước 2: Xác định mục tiêu chi phí và thời gian

Mục tiêu chínhNên ưu tiên khu vực
Cần tiết kiệm ngân sách tối đaNam Á (Ấn Độ, Bangladesh), châu Phi (Kenya, Nigeria)
Cần cân bằng giữa chi phí và kiểm soátĐông Nam Á (Việt Nam, Philippines, Malaysia hoặc Nearshore Outsourcing)
Cần bảo mật cao, bảo hành lâu dàiSingapore, Đông Âu, Mỹ, EU

Bước 3: So sánh khung kỹ năng theo khu vực

Quốc giaMạnh về kỹ năng gì?
Ukraine, Ba LanBackend, AI, Blockchain, Security
Việt NamWeb App, Mobile App, ERP, tích hợp hệ thống
PhilippinesQA, customer support, BPO
Ấn ĐộToàn diện, nhưng cần kiểm tra kỹ năng theo từng công ty
SingaporeHigh-end system, ngân hàng, bảo mật

Bước 4: Kiểm tra khả năng phối hợp (múi giờ, giao tiếp, quy trình)

Yếu tố đánh giáCách kiểm tra hiệu quả
Múi giờĐặt thử cuộc họp demo và đo thời gian phản hồi
Giao tiếpGửi email test yêu cầu kỹ thuật và đánh giá độ rõ ràng
Quy trình làm việcHỏi họ có dùng Jira, Git, CI/CD, test case hay không

Bước 5: Thử nghiệm bằng một sprint nhỏ

Doanh nghiệp không ký hợp đồng dài hạn ngay mà hãy:

  • Làm thử 1 sprint (2 tuần) hoặc module nhỏ (login, payment,…).
  • Đánh giá:
    • Đúng deadline không?
    • Giao tiếp có rõ không?
    • Code có test và tài liệu đi kèm không?

Nếu đạt kỳ vọng hãy mở rộng giai đoạn sau. Nếu không hãy chuyển đơn vị hợp tác.

Không nên ký hợp đồng dài hạn mà nên thử nghiệm bằng một sprint nhỏ trước
Không nên ký hợp đồng dài hạn mà nên thử nghiệm bằng một sprint nhỏ trước

Kết luận: Chênh lệch giá là điều tất yếu nhưng đừng mua rủi ro vì ham rẻ

Chi phí gia công phần mềm thấp không đồng nghĩa với hiệu quả cao, nếu doanh nghiệp chỉ nhìn vào bảng giá mà không đánh giá đến các tiêu chí:

  • Năng lực kỹ thuật
  • Cách giao tiếp
  • Quy trình triển khai
  • Mức độ bảo mật và pháp lý

Thì việc “tiết kiệm” có thể trở thành gánh nặng khi dự án trễ tiến độ, lỗi chồng lỗi hoặc phải viết lại toàn bộ dự án.

Câu hỏi thường gặp (FAQ)

Chi phí thuê lập trình viên ở Việt Nam hiện nay là bao nhiêu?

Tính theo giờ, giá dao động từ 12 – 30 USD/giờ tùy theo cấp độ. Tính theo tháng, junior khoảng 15–20 triệu, senior từ 30–50 triệu còn full-stack lead có thể trên 60 triệu.

Có nên thuê dev từ châu Phi (giá rất rẻ) không?

Nếu doanh nghiệp có khả năng kiểm tra kỹ thuật chặt chẽ có thể cân nhắc. Tuy nhiên, rủi ro về bảo mật, khả năng giao tiếp và chất lượng code khá cao. Ngoài ra, điều này còn không phù hợp với dự án cần gấp hoặc yêu cầu tích hợp hệ thống phức tạp.

Lệch múi giờ có ảnh hưởng đến tiến độ thật không?

Có. Một dự án cần họp hàng ngày hoặc yêu cầu phản hồi liên tục sẽ rất khó nếu lệch múi giờ >6 tiếng. Nếu doanh nghiệp không thể phản hồi nhanh, Offshore dễ dẫn đến hiểu sai yêu cầu và chậm fix.

Có thể kết hợp nhiều khu vực (Hybrid Region Model) không?

Hoàn toàn có. Nhiều công ty Việt hiện đang dùng mô hình này:
1. Dev team tại Philippines hoặc Bangladesh (giá rẻ)
2. Quản lý và kiểm thử tại Việt Nam (Onshore)
Khi biết cách kết hợp chi phí thấp  =và kiểm soát tốt

Quốc gia nào phù hợp với doanh nghiệp Việt Nam nhất nếu lần đầu thuê outsource quốc tế?

Philippines và Malaysia là 2 lựa chọn phổ biến bởi các lý do sau đây:
1. Giao tiếp tiếng Anh tốt
2. Múi giờ trùng hoặc lệch nhẹ
3. Nền công nghệ phát triển ổn định
Nếu có thể tự kiểm soát kỹ thuật, doanh nghiệp hoàn toàn có thể mở rộng dần sang Ukraine hoặc Ấn Độ để tối ưu chi phí.

Để lại một bình luận

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*